Emergency Response Teams (ERT)

Resize page text:

Emergency Response Teams (ERT) are comprised of PMRT staff specialized in responding to critical incidents such as acts of school violence, natural disasters such as earthquakes, fires.. etc. or acts of terror or critical incidents.  ERT provide on-scene consultation and crisis intervention services to survivors and their families, victims, first responders, and the community.  In a major event, ERT is activated through the DMH Disaster Services Unit at the request of the Los Angeles City and/or County Office of Emergency Management.

In a major event, EOTD collaborates with Disaster Services Unit and the Los Angeles County Office of Emergency Management. to provide services to the cities and communities located within Los Angeles County when such incidents occur.
